+ \item \texttt{passphrase} (wpa) \\
|
|
|
+ 0 treats the wpa psk as a text passphrase; 1 treats wpa psk as
|
|
|
+ encoded passphrase. You can generate an encoded passphrase with
|
|
|
+ the wpa\_passphrase utility. This is especially useful if your
|
|
|
+ passphrase contains special characters. This option only works
|
|
|
+ when using mac80211 or atheros type devices.
